Jerry Moore (American Football, Born 1949)
Jerry Porter Moore (born March 16, 1949) is an American former professional football player who played defensive back for four seasons in the National Football League (NFL) with the Chicago Bears and New Orleans Saints. Jerry Moore (baseball)
Jeremiah S. Moore (c. 1855 – September 26, 1890) was a Major League Baseball catcher/outfielder in the 19th century. He was a native of Windsor, Ontario, Canada. In 1884 he played for the Altoona Mountain City of the Union Association and the Cleveland Blues of the National League. In 1885 he played for the Detroit Wolverines, also of the National League. In 20 Union Association games he batted .312 (25-for-80), but in 15 National League games he hit only .189 (10-for-53).
